Numbers 3:36

And [under] the custody and charge of the sons of Merari
[shall be] the boards of the tabernacle
Both of the holy and the most holy place, which were the walls of the tabernacle, and which were covered with curtains; these when taken down for journeying were committed to the care of the Merarites; and because these, with what, follow, were a heavy carriage, they were allowed wagons to carry them; and who on this account had more wagons given them than to the Gershonites, for the Kohathites had none, ( Numbers 7:6-9 ) ;

and the bars thereof;
which kept the boards tight and close, see ( Exodus 26:26 ) ;

and the pillars thereof;
the pillars on which the vail was hung, that divided between the holy and most holy place, and, on which the hanging was put for the door of the vail, ( Exodus 26:32 Exodus 26:37 ) ;

and the sockets thereof;
in which both the boards and pillars were put, ( Exodus 26:19 Exodus 26:32 Exodus 26:37 ) .

Números 3:36 In-Context

34 Los enumerados en el censo de todos los varones de un mes arriba eran seis mil doscientos.
35 Y el jefe de las casas paternas de las familias de Merari era Zuriel, hijo de Abihail. Habían de acampar al lado norte del tabernáculo.
36 A cargo de los hijos de Merari estaban el maderaje del tabernáculo, sus barras, sus columnas, sus basas, todos sus enseres y el servicio relacionado con ellos,
37 las columnas alrededor del atrio con sus basas, sus estacas y sus cuerdas.
38 Los que habían de acampar delante del tabernáculo al oriente, delante de la tienda de reunión hacia la salida del sol, eran Moisés, Aarón y sus hijos, desempeñando los deberes del santuario para cumplir la obligación de los hijos de Israel; pero el extraño que se acercara, moriría.
